Display Names
The beta launch of Display Names to FA+ members went over very well! While display names themselves didn’t have issues, they did cause some other minor bugs that our team quickly took care of and resolved.
In addition to the launch of Display Names, we took the time to make some fixes in regards to the fit and function of the site!
Changelog of things recent
*The shop link and FA+ page are now visible to guests.
●Two new categories added:
∘"3D Models"- For submissions involving 3D models.
∘"Virtual Photography"- Includes 3D renders, VR scenes, virtual world photography (Second Life, VRC, etc.), and more.
●Fixed an issue where links on some notifications were unable to be clicked.
●Changes to how bot crawlers use data from our webpages in an attempt to squash spam bots.
●Fuzzy timestamps are now more cursed as of half-o-bit ago.
●Changed the display of user information in the user navigation bar on smaller screens to accommodate the new, longer display name functionality.

Internet Safety
It has been brought to our attention that there are third party services that are being used to crawl Fur Affinity, among many other sites, for information. We would like to encourage our users to be mindful of any information they post publicly. Anything on your profile, journals, and General-rated submissions are publicly visible unless you have your account set to “block guests” via https://www.furaffinity.net/control.....site-settings/. In addition, any shouts or comments you make on other people's profile pages, journals or General-rated submissions will be visible unless the page owner has disabled guest access as well. For your own safety we advise you to not post anything that could publicly identify you, or any sensitive information about yourself. This is good advice not just for FA, but the internet as a whole, too!
